import arcpy
from arcpy import env
#Setting the env workspace to be an SDE geodatabase
#
env.workspace = r'C:\sde_at_DB101.sde'
#Getting the existing polygon feature class as input parameter
#
GetExistingPolyFC = arcpy.GetParameterAsText(0)
GetPolyFC = GetExistingPolyFC
# Truncate a feature class if it exists
#
if arcpy.Exists(GetPolyFC):
arcpy.AddMessage("Polygon feature class exists, start working...")
arcpy.TruncateTable_management(r'C:\sde_at_DB_101.sde\%s' %GetPolyFC)
arcpy.AddMessage("Truncating table is complete")
else:
arcpy.AddMessage("Polygon feature class does not exist")
